I'm about to replace my two AF1150 batteries. They're currently Interstate Deep Cycle 12 volts wired in parallel.
I'm thinking of going with two 6Volt golf cart batteries. Sam's sells the Duracell EGC2 for 150 bucks. Specs:
20 amp hour rate: 230
5 amp hour rate:174
Battery electrolyte composition: acid
Battery end type: top post
Battery purpose: deep cycle
BCI group size: GC2
Freight class: 65
Minutes at 25 amps: 448
Minutes at 75 amps: 120
Terminal type: DIN
Volts: six
I was thinking that with the 2 two wired in series, I'd be better off on the Amp Hour rating. Any opinions?
Thanks as always
Good choice. Mine are going on 7 years now and seem to be as good as when I bought them.
It’s not a good choice because they won’t fit in his camper….doesn’t matter if they last 20 years….if they’re sitting at home.
Never said they would fit, only that they are good batteries. I assume he knows how to read dimensions and use a tape measure. :R
